2017 All-Alpena News Girls Basketball Team
2017 Player of the Year
Vanessa Schook
Hillman
*Class D all-state second team
*Three-time All-Alpena News first team selection
*North Star League first team
*Led the area in scoring with 19 points per game and averaged 2.4 rebounds per game
*Became Hillman’s all-time girls basketball scorer with 1,260 career points
*Led the Tigers to a second regional appearance in three seasons
*Helped Hillman win a third straight North Star League Big Dipper division title and a district championship

Coach of the Year
John Kuzewski
With team depth and plenty of talent, expectations were high for the Hillman girls basketball team. With Kuzewski at the helm, the Tigers delivered on that potential and finished with a 21-2 record. Along the way, Hillman won 21 straight games and established itself as the top team in the North Star League. The Tigers won their third straight league title and easily won their second district title in three seasons. The Tigers’ quest for a regional title fell short, but Hillman never stopped playing and nearly earned a spot in the regional final. Under Kuzewski, the Tigers have become one of the area’s most consistent programs and look to have brighter days ahead on the hardwood.
